I called Mazdaspeed a few months back and was told that the 13b had to be purchased through the dealer network. He did not disclose why.

My 1.6L crate from Mazda showed up about a week and a half ago. I paid $16xx for it delivered....right before the price increase.

According to their website, current price for a 1.6 crate motor is $2470.50 (was $1495 or so when i ordered mine at the end of October). So figure $150 or so for shipping. Yeah, they were backordered when SM folks found out about the price jump--

Part number: B61P-02-300 - LONG BLOCK, 1.6 (Inventory check isn't coming up for me right now....)
